Embarking on the Journey: Practical Considerations

For those inspired to embark on the journey up Tibet’s sky-ladders, several practical considerations must be taken into account. The region’s high altitude and rugged terrain present unique challenges, requiring careful planning and preparation. Here are some key factors to consider:

  • Physical Fitness: The ascent of sky-ladders demands a high level of physical fitness. Climbers should engage in regular training and conditioning to prepare for the strenuous nature of the journey.
  • Acclimatization: Given Tibet’s high altitude, proper acclimatization is crucial to prevent altitude sickness. Travelers should allow time to adjust to the altitude before attempting the ascent.
  • Gear and Equipment: Appropriate gear is essential for a safe and successful climb. This includes sturdy hiking boots, weather-appropriate clothing, and climbing equipment such as ropes and harnesses.
  • Guides and Permits: Hiring experienced guides is recommended, as they can provide valuable insights and assistance. Additionally, necessary permits must be obtained prior to embarking on the journey.
